A: Absolutely. In fact, SP6 is designed to be installed after the full VS6 suite (VB6, VC++, VJ++, etc.).
If you have an active Visual Studio subscription, the MSDN download archive contains the original VB6 SP6 image (VB60SP6.EXE). Search within "Visual Studio 6.0 Service Packs".
Service Pack 6 was the final official service pack released by Microsoft for the Visual Basic 6.0 development environment. Released in early 2004, it represented the culmination of years of bug fixes, security patches, and stability improvements.
While Microsoft ended mainstream support for VB6 years ago, SP6 is widely considered the "gold standard" for the IDE (Integrated Development Environment). It is the most stable version available and is required for many third-party controls and add-ins to function correctly.
SP6 addressed over 100 specific issues found in previous versions. While the changelog is extensive, the most impactful improvements include:
If you are not a developer but are trying to run an old VB6 application and receiving errors about missing DLLs, you do not need the massive SP6 developer pack. Instead, you need the Visual Basic 6.0 SP6 Run-time Redistribution Pack.
A: Yes. Microsoft never charged for service packs. All legitimate sources listed above are free.
Microsoft Visual Basic 6.0 remains one of the most beloved and productive development environments ever released. Even years after mainstream support ended, countless legacy business applications, COM components, and automation tools continue to run on VB6. To ensure stability, security, and compatibility—especially on modern Windows versions—applying Visual Basic 6.0 Service Pack 6 (SP6) is not optional. It’s essential.
A: No. SP6 requires a functional, registered VB6 installation. Microsoft no longer issues new keys for VB6; you must use an existing license.
A: Absolutely. In fact, SP6 is designed to be installed after the full VS6 suite (VB6, VC++, VJ++, etc.).
If you have an active Visual Studio subscription, the MSDN download archive contains the original VB6 SP6 image (VB60SP6.EXE). Search within "Visual Studio 6.0 Service Packs".
Service Pack 6 was the final official service pack released by Microsoft for the Visual Basic 6.0 development environment. Released in early 2004, it represented the culmination of years of bug fixes, security patches, and stability improvements.
While Microsoft ended mainstream support for VB6 years ago, SP6 is widely considered the "gold standard" for the IDE (Integrated Development Environment). It is the most stable version available and is required for many third-party controls and add-ins to function correctly.
SP6 addressed over 100 specific issues found in previous versions. While the changelog is extensive, the most impactful improvements include:
If you are not a developer but are trying to run an old VB6 application and receiving errors about missing DLLs, you do not need the massive SP6 developer pack. Instead, you need the Visual Basic 6.0 SP6 Run-time Redistribution Pack.
A: Yes. Microsoft never charged for service packs. All legitimate sources listed above are free.
Microsoft Visual Basic 6.0 remains one of the most beloved and productive development environments ever released. Even years after mainstream support ended, countless legacy business applications, COM components, and automation tools continue to run on VB6. To ensure stability, security, and compatibility—especially on modern Windows versions—applying Visual Basic 6.0 Service Pack 6 (SP6) is not optional. It’s essential.
A: No. SP6 requires a functional, registered VB6 installation. Microsoft no longer issues new keys for VB6; you must use an existing license.